First Busey’s CFO departure ‘very surprising,’ says Piper Sandler
CFO Departure: First Busey announced the unexpected departure of CFO Jeff Jones, which was not related to any disagreements regarding the company's financials or operations, nor the acquisition of CrossFirst.
Market Reaction: Piper Sandler expressed surprise at Jones' exit but maintained an Overweight rating on First Busey stock with a price target of $28, noting that Jones was enthusiastic about the merger with CrossFirst.

- Significant Profit Growth: First Busey Corp's Q4 net income reached $56.16 million, with earnings per share (EPS) of $0.63, a substantial increase from last year's $28.11 million and $0.49 EPS, indicating a marked improvement in profitability.
- Adjusted Earnings Exceed Expectations: Excluding special items, the company reported adjusted earnings of $60.60 million, or $0.68 per share, surpassing analysts' expectations of $0.62, reflecting strong performance in its core business operations.
- Revenue Surge: The company's Q4 revenue rose 71.4% year-over-year to $200.25 million, up from $116.80 million last year, demonstrating a robust recovery in market demand and sales.

Third Quarter Profit: First Busey Corp. reported a third-quarter profit of $51.97 million, or $0.58 per share, an increase from $32.00 million, or $0.55 per share, in the previous year.
Adjusted Earnings: The company’s adjusted earnings for the period were $57.37 million, or $0.64 per share, surpassing analysts' expectations of $0.62 per share.
Revenue Growth: First Busey Corp. experienced a significant revenue increase of 67.1%, reaching $197.32 million compared to $118.08 million last year.

Analyst Ratings Overview for First Busey
- Recent Analyst Actions: Six analysts evaluated First Busey in the last quarter, showing a mix of bullish and bearish sentiments. The ratings over the last 30 days indicate a shift, with 4 analysts somewhat bullish, 2 indifferent, and no bearish ratings.
- Price Target Insights: The average 12-month price target is $27.5, with a high of $30.00 and a low of $25.00. This represents a 4.76% increase from the previous average of $26.25.
Detailed Analyst Evaluations
- Analyst Actions: Notable changes include Daniel Tamayo from Raymond James raising his target from $27.00 to $28.00, while Damon Delmonte from Keefe, Bruyette & Woods lowered his target from $30.00 to $29.00. Financial Performance Metrics
- Market Capitalization: First Busey boasts a market capitalization that exceeds industry averages, indicating strong market presence.
- Revenue Growth: The company reported a remarkable revenue growth rate of 70.38% as of June 30, 2025, significantly outperforming peers in the Financials sector.
- Profitability Challenges: First Busey's net margin stands at 23.94%, which is below industry standards, suggesting potential issues with cost management.
- Return Metrics: The company’s Return on Equity (ROE) is 2.06% and Return on Assets (ROA) is 0.25%, both below industry averages, indicating challenges in capital efficiency and asset utilization.
- Debt Management: With a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.13, First Busey demonstrates a conservative approach to debt, suggesting a balanced financial strategy.
